Luke Chobanian, LMSW

Luke Chobanian (He/Him) – is a radiant and personable therapist at Sage Mind Psychology. Luke is currently practicing as a Licensed Masters Social Worker. He earned his masters degree in Clinical Social Work from Boston University. Luke has experience working across various age groups and community settings, specializing in providing client centered and humanistic therapy. Luke’s therapeutic style draws fromCBT and DBT techniques with a focus supporting a client in their growth and personal healing. Luke is an incredibly warm and charismatic person, with a true passion for experiencing life and culture. Luke is an LGBTQIA+ therapist, identifying as queer, and is very passionate about providing LGBTQIA+ affirming care.
Luke is experienced with working with individuals struggling through various mental health issues ranging from depression, anxiety, trauma, grief, emotional dysregulation, attention deficit disorder, addiction, and relationships issues. Luke has gained extensive experience over the years working with children, adolescents, adults, and families systems in various community mental health settings. In therapy, Luke utilizes a person centered approach, focusing on developing strategies for goal orientation, motivation, and empowerment. Luke is skilled in providing evidence-based approaches including: Trauma Informed Care,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avioral Therapy (DBT), Mindfulness, Creative Arts Therapy, and Psychodynamic Therapy to help support a client in treatment.
